    Third Conservative leadership debate suffers from poor attendance and lack of viewers – By Catherine Lévesque (National Post) / Aug 3, 2022

    The three candidates focused on areas that had not been thoroughly covered in previous debates, such as Indigenous issues, transportation and climate change

    There were no sad trombones in this third official debate held by the Conservative Party of Canada, but also very little disagreements from the three of the five leadership candidates who chose to show up in a tiny studio in Ottawa in the dead of summer.

    Jean Charest, Roman Baber and Scott Aitchison made their final pleas to the few dozen members who were watching the live feed online on Facebook. At its peak, approximately 300 people tuned in to watch it but near the end of the debate, less than 100 people were still listening.

    The party’s feed on YouTube indicated more than 18,000 views on Thursday morning, but it is unclear who tuned in to listen during the debate as it was happening.

    Pierre Poilievre and Leslyn Lewis decided not to attend, focusing on meeting members directly.
